У меня довольно много проблем с перенаправлением моего доменного имени (то есть .st) на мой веб-сервер на Amazon EC2.
Я добавил запись A в свои расширенные настройки DNS через веб-консоль моего регистратора. Это запись A, которая указывает на мой Amazon Elastic IP, подключенный к моему экземпляру Amazon EC2. Посещение этого эластичного IP-адреса в моем браузере фактически отправляет меня на мой веб-сайт.
Первичный DNS-сервер - ns1.nic.st. (Назначается веб-консолью, когда я решаю добавить A-запись). Я предполагаю, что это означает, что я добавляю a-запись на собственный DNS-сервер моего регистратора.
nslookup и ping говорят мне, что DNS-сервер жив.
~$nslookup ns1.nic.st
Server: 172.16.0.23
Address: 172.16.0.23#53
Non-authoritative answer:
Name: ns1.nic.st
Address: 195.178.160.40
но nslookup на моем доменном имени выдает ошибку "не могу найти":
~$nslookup upmo.st
Server: 172.16.0.23
Address: 172.16.0.23#53
Non-authoritative answer:
*** Can't find upmo.st: No answer
Прошло 24 часа с тех пор, как я добавил эту запись A, есть ли у кого-нибудь представление о том, почему это происходит?
Хлюпать sez:
62,5% запросов завершатся ошибкой на 195.178.160.2 (ns1.bahnhof.net) - такой записи нет
37,5% запросов завершатся неудачей на 195.178.160.40 (ns1.nic.st) - такой записи нет
Итак, тот, кто хранит ваши записи DNS (bahnhof.net, nic.st), на самом деле не обслуживает эти записи. Лучше всего связаться с ними, чтобы исправить это, или переместите свой DNS-хостинг к провайдеру, который работает.